What Are Dust Explosion-Proof Connection Boxes?

Dust explosion-proof connection boxes are designed to protect electrical connections from igniting combustible dust particles. These boxes are constructed to withstand explosions and prevent dust ingress, ensuring safe operation in environments such as food processing, pharmaceuticals, and woodworking industries.

Key Features of Dust Explosion-Proof Connection Boxes

When selecting dust explosion-proof connection boxes, several key features should be considered:

  • Enclosure Ratings: Ensure the connection box has the appropriate IP (Ingress Protection) and Ex (Explosion Protection) ratings for your specific environment. Common ratings include IP65 and Ex d for hazardous locations.

  • Material Composition: Boxes are typically made from materials resistant to corrosion and impact. Common materials include aluminum, stainless steel, and engineering plastics.

  • Sealing Mechanisms: Effective sealing is critical to prevent dust ingress. Look for connection boxes with robust gaskets and sealing structures that ensure durability and reliability.

  • Temperature Ratings: Choose boxes that can operate within the required temperature range without risking compromise. This is crucial in environments where heat from electrical components can ignite dust.

Common Applications for Dust Explosion-Proof Connection Boxes

These specialized boxes are used in various industrial settings, such as:

  • Manufacturing Plants: Especially in sectors dealing with powders, grains, or other fine particulates.
  • Food Processing Facilities: To prevent contamination and explosions when processing flours and other ingredients.
  • Chemical Processing: Where venting potential dust and chemicals safely is a priority.
  • Woodworking: To manage the fine wood dust generated in cutting and milling processes.

Compliance and Standards

Understanding the relevant standards for dust explosion-proof equipment is crucial. Familiarize yourself with:

  • ATEX Directive: For equipment used within the European Economic Area.
  • NEC (National Electrical Code): Relevant in the United States, particularly Article 500, which deals with the classification of hazardous locations.
  • IECEx: International certification for equipment used in explosive atmospheres.
